Frequently Asked Questions

All memberships are valid for one year from the date of purchase.

Yes! Museum memberships make meaningful gifts for art lovers, students, and families. Gift memberships include all standard benefits.

You can join or renew online or in person at the museum’s front desk.

Yes. You can upgrade at any time by paying the difference between your current level and your desired level, and you’ll immediately receive the additional benefits.

Yes, members receive a physical card for easy admission and discount verification.

Your membership directly supports exhibitions, educational programs, and the preservation of the museum’s permanent collection—helping the Hilliard remain a vibrant cultural hub for the university and wider regional community.

Memberships are considered a donation and are partially or fully tax-deductible, depending on the level. The museum will provide documentation for your records.
